    Time for another episode of That Cost's How Muuuchhhh?? We've been seeing a lot of trendy decor all over TikTok, Pinterest and TH-cam recently.
    The West Elm Solstice Line has this beautiful table that ranges from $600 to $800 online, depending on the size of it. They also have a taller entry way table that is $700, so I decided I wanted to make a hybrid of all of these to fit at the end of my bed! I am also remaking this Ferm Living Pond Mirror that retails for $469, which personally is a bit too much to spend on a mirror of this size!

    I believe that the pistol grip glass cutter has a place for you to put the oil inside it. The bottom gold "button" should open and you can add oil inside the tool. Then when you apply pressure the oil can seep out through the scoring portion helping lubricate the tool to score the glass better. My grandfather used to make stained glass windows for various churches my the area. I helped him out a lot with his work and he had an older version of this tool, could be different but it looks the same.

    Loved these DIYs as someone who is both an amateur woodworker AND beginner stained glass artist!
    Commenting because I have a few tips that I thought could help you with any future glass/mirror cutting projects. The handle of the glass cutting tool you were using should actually twist open at the end and hold oil, so you don’t have to apply it to the tip externally. I would also look into alternative ways to grip your scorer, the way you held it works but is more tiring than other options. Also, I was taught to push more forward than down as it gives you more control and is easier on your arms.
    Also for anyone looking to start out, try not to backtrack or pick up the tool mid-score, it exponentially increases the chances of your piece breaking in the wrong direction. Also the pencil trick works for simple, large cuts but they sell clamps and pliers that would work better for most applications.
